body{		
			height: 100%;
			font-size: 100.1%;
			background-color: #e4e4d7;
			color: #27205d;
			
}

p {
			font: 0.75em/1.2em Arial, Helvetica, serif;

}

a {			
			font: 12px/1.2em Arial, Helvetica, serif;
			font-weight: bold;
			text-decoration: none;
			color: orange;
}

h1{
			font: 1.50em/1.2em Arial, Helvetica, bold serif;		

}

h2{			font: 1.10em/1.2em Arial, Helvetica, bold serif;	
}

strong {		font-weight: bold;
			
}

ul {			
			list-style: square;
			padding-left: 50px;
}

li {			
			font: 0.75em/1.2em Arial, Helvetica, serif;
			padding-left: 10px;		
}

td {
			vertical-align: top;
			height: 6.40em;
			font: 0.75em/1.2em Arial, Helvetica, serif;
}
.iconholder{
		float: left;
		width: 70px;
		height: 70px;
		padding: 0px 5px 0px 0px;
}

#wrapper{ 
		
		width: 1000px; 
		min-height: 100%;
		height: auto !important; 
		margin: 0 auto -77px;
		background: url(/images/bg_body.png) white repeat-y;
}

#header{
		width: 1000px;
		height: 158px;
		background: url(/images/top_header.png);
		z-index: 0;
}

#powered{	
		position: absolute;
		margin: 72px 0 0 420px;
		width: 180px;
		height: 15px;
}

.url{
		float: left;
		width: 60px;
		height: 15px;
		
}
.url a {
			width: 60px;
			height: 15px;
			display: block;
}

.url a span {
			visibility: hidden;
}

#navHolder{
		position: relative;
		float: left;
		margin: 0;
		width: 1000px;
		height: 30px;
		background: url(/images/nav_gradient_bg.png) repeat-x;
}

#nav{
		position: relative;
		margin: 0px 0px 0px 52px;
		height: 30px;
		width: 700px;
		z-index: 2;
}

.btnhome {		
			float: left;
			width: 90px;
			height: 30px;
			cursor: pointer;
			background: url(/images/home_btn.png) no-repeat;			
}

.btnhome a {
			width: 90px;
			height: 30px;
			display: block;
}

.btnhome a span {
			visibility: hidden;
}

.btnprog {		
			float: left;
			width: 135px;
			height: 30px;
			cursor: pointer;
			background: url(/images/programma_btn.png) no-repeat;			
}

.btnprog a {
			width: 135px;
			height: 30px;
			display: block;
}

.btnprog a span {
			visibility: hidden;
}

.btndeelnemers {		
			float: left;
			width: 145px;
			height: 30px;
			cursor: pointer;
			background: url(/images/deelnemers_btn.png) no-repeat;			
}

.btndeelnemers a {
			width: 145px;
			height: 30px;
			display: block;
}

.btndeelnemers a span {
			visibility: hidden;
}

.btninschrijven {		
			float: left;
			width: 145px;
			height: 30px;
			cursor: pointer;
			background: url(/images/inschrijven_btn.png) no-repeat;			
}

.btninschrijven a {
			width: 145px;
			height: 30px;
			display: block;
}

.btninschrijven a span {
			visibility: hidden;
}

#container{	
			position: relative;
			margin: 0;
			width: 100%;
			height: 500px;
			z-index: 0;
}

#containertwo{	
			/*position: relative;*/
			float: left;
			background: url(/images/bg_body.png) white repeat-y;
			margin: 0px;
			/*width: 100%;*/
			min-height: 450px;
			/*z-index: 3;*/
}


.leftcontainer{
				float: left;
				margin: 38px 0 0 0;
				width: 630px;
				height: 100%;
					z-index: 0;
			
		}

#maincontent{
				float: left;
				height: 100%;
				width: 558px;
				padding-bottom: 50px;
			
}

.scrollbar {
				
				float: left;				
				position: relative;
				width: auto;
				height: auto;
				overflow: auto;
				padding: 50px 22px 10px 50px;
}



#visual{
				float: left;
				width: 420px;
				height: 384px;
				background: url(/images/left_homeImage.png);
			}

#highlight{	
				float: left;
				margin: 10px 0 0 0;
				width: 200px;
		
}

.tabelcontainer {
						position: relative;
						margin-top: 35px;
						width: 200px; 
						height: 65px;  
				
}

.line {
						
						height: 7px;
						margin: 0;
						background: url(/images/seperator.png) no-repeat;
	
}
	
.headline{	
						height: 16px;
						margin: 25px 0 0 0;
}
	
.info{
						height: 12px;
						margin: 5px 0 0 0;
}
	
.link{
						height: 12px;
						margin: 2px 0 0 0;
}


#right{
		position: relative;
		float: left;
		margin: -70px 0 0 10px;
		width: 350px;
		height: 100%;
		background: url(/images/right_inschrijving.png) no-repeat;
		z-index: 5;
}

#right_top{
		position: absolute;
		margin: -40px 0 0 640px;
		width: 350px;
		height: 465px;
		background: url(/images/right_inschrijving.png) no-repeat;
		z-index: 1000;
}

#forcedbtn{
		width: 193px;
		height: 59px;
		
}


#inschrijven {
		position: relative;
		margin: 100px 0 0 100px;
		width: 193px;
		height: 59px;
		z-index: 1001;
}

#inschrijven a {
			width: 193px;
			height: 59px;
			display: block;
}

#inschrijven a span {
			visibility: hidden;
			z-index: 1003;
}


#rightcontent{
		position: relative;
		margin: 70px 0 0 28px;
		width: 275px;
		height: 200px;
		z-index: 999;
}

#rightcontent p{
		font-size: 0.7em;
		line-height: 17px;
}

#iconholder{
		position: relative;
		margin: 0px auto;
		width: 1000px;
		height: 77px;
		background: url(/images/icon_bg.png) no-repeat;
}

#submenu{
		
		position: relative;
		margin: -2px 0 0 45px;
		padding-top: 12px;
		width: 100%;
		height: 30px;
		background-color: #e4e4d7;
}

#submenu a{
		font-size: 11px;
		padding: 2px 20px 0 0;
		font-weight: normal;
		color: #27205d;
}

#submenutwo{
		
		position: relative;
		margin: 90px 0 0 45px;
		width: 400px;
		height: 50px;
}

#submenutwo a{
		font-size: 11px;
		padding: 2px 20px 0 0;
		font-weight: normal;
		color: #27205d;
}


.footer, .push{
		height: 77px;
		
}
.footer {
		float: left;
		position: relative;
		background: url(/images/icon_bg.png) no-repeat;
		width: 1000px;
		margin: 0 auto;
}






















/* EDITOR PROPERTIES - PLEASE DON'T DELETE THIS LINE TO AVOID DUPLICATE PROPERTIES */

